James S. de Benneville
James S. de Benneville (James Seguin De Benneville, James S. De Benneville, James Seguin Benneville)
Share This
James S. de Benneville (James Seguin De Benneville, James S. De Benneville, James Seguin Benneville, James S. de Benneville)